Has anyone done this lately? We did an Illuminations Cruise last trip & loved it. Was wondering if the MK version would be as nice. Where do they leave from? Is it the same kind of boats? Thanks for any info. :D
 
>Has anyone done this lately?
Yes, and it has become more popular since "Wishes" started in October.

>We did an Illuminations Cruise last trip & loved it. Was wondering if the MK version would be as nice.
It is different. Whereas at IllumiNations, there is very little to do and see before the show, Crescent Lake, Swan Dolphin, MGM and the BoardWalk.......
While at The Magic Kingdom, there is the LARGE Bay Lake, all the resorts, the Wedding Chapel, and if your lucky the Electric water Pageant.

>Where do they leave from?
Just about every resort, although most of the boats are "issued" from Wilderness Lodge, so if you are not staying at a monorail resort, you may as well request a WL departure.

>Is it the same kind of boats?
Except for The Grand One, which is a large luxury cruiser, all the fireworks cruises are on Party Pontoons, just like at IllumiNations, it's just that they use a few of the smaller boats (20 footer?) while at IllumiNations it is almost exclusively the larger (24 footer?) pontoons. Oh, they also have two large boats called the MK 1 and the MK 2, and they are used in conjunction with the Magical Gatherings groups (I rather not discuss these boats).

With that said, let me add that Wishes is a beautiful presentation and the view from the boat (parked out in Seven Seas Lagoon) is unmatched! You get the full effect with the castle strategically centered inside the fireworks. I can't stress enough what a difference positioning makes with this show.

We took the MK fireworks cruise this Dec. ,fireworks very nice. Still we will not take one again unless there is music. The music is most important and you can not hear all of it on the water. Wish Disney would have it on the boats makes a big difference.
